What solved was the following
1) I started in safe mode, and copied scvhost.exe back to c:\windows\system32
2) I restarted again in safe mode and managed to delete the whole program
in start-setting-control panel-add/remove programs
3) I reinstalled the program

If there is an empty screen , try cntrl alt del, or right mouseclick in the bottom row, to get into task manager, and in application sgo to new task and type explorer or explorer.exe
This will bring the desktop often back.I found there was a problem with Mcafee when I saw the news on internet, Then I typed in google: update mcafee and found supposed solutions which did not help me, I found the above solution, which solved the problems ( no internet, no way of running programs, no way of installing or de-installing programs) .
